Abstract

本实用新型属于竹制型材技术领域,具体涉及一种竹材展开重组层集材。该竹材展开重组层集材,它由至少两层展开竹材重组单板分层叠加,用粘胶剂粘合热压形成一个整合体,其上表面和下表面均为竹青面。本实用新型纵向强度大,刚性好,弹性模量高,表面硬度高,耐磨耐腐蚀,强重比优于钢材,适合制作家居地板、客车底板、船用仓板、集装箱底板、家具板、竹材结构屋用材料、建筑工程材料等,应用范围广泛,成本低。

The utility model belongs to the technical field of bamboo profiles, and in particular relates to an expanded and recombined layer aggregate of bamboo. The expanded and restructured bamboo aggregate is composed of at least two layers of expanded bamboo restructured veneers layered and superimposed, bonded and hot-pressed with an adhesive to form an integrated body, the upper surface and the lower surface of which are bamboo green surfaces. The utility model has high longitudinal strength, good rigidity, high elastic modulus, high surface hardness, wear resistance and corrosion resistance, and the strength-to-weight ratio is superior to steel, and is suitable for making home floors, passenger car floors, ship warehouse panels, container floors, furniture panels, and bamboo materials. Structural housing materials, construction engineering materials, etc., have a wide range of applications and low cost.

Description

Bamboo wood launches the logging of reorganization layer
Technical field
The utility model belongs to bamboo section bar technical field, is specifically related to a kind of bamboo wood and launches the logging of reorganization layer.
Background technology
Existing laminated bamboo-wood composite lumber, heavy bamboo silk material, be bamboo processing to be become sheet or strip materials such as thin bamboo strip, bamboo curtain splint, bamboo bundle, bamboo chip, or the continuous bamboo thin veneer that makes through rotary-cut of thick bamboo tube, the laminated board that processes with operations such as timber central layer drying, applying glue assembly, hot pressing, or the heavy bamboo clappers that is processed into without the timber central layer again.But needing the application of higher-strength, existing laminated bamboo-wood composite lumber, heavy bamboo silk material are to be difficult to meet the requirements of.
Summary of the invention
The purpose of this utility model provides a kind ofly launches the recombination single-plate material as surface layer, bottom with bamboo wood, or sandwich layer, and the bamboo wood with higher-strength launches the logging of reorganization layer.
The utility model is to realize above-mentioned purpose by the following technical solutions: this bamboo wood launches the logging of reorganization layer, it is superposeed by two-layer at least expansion bamboo wood recombination single-plate layering, form an integrate body with the bonding hot pressing of adhesive, its upper surface and lower surface are bamboo strip.
More particularly, it is bonded for three layers by surface layer, sandwich layer, bottom, and surface layer, bottom adopt and launch the bamboo wood recombination single-plate, and sandwich layer adopts and launches bamboo wood recombination single-plate or wood single-plate.
When sandwich layer adopted expansion bamboo wood recombination single-plate, three layers of bamboo wood veneer can be the stacks of bamboo fiber direction vertical consistency, also can be crisscross stacks.
Described adhesive adopts modified environment-friendly phenolic resins or modified environment-friendly Lauxite.
The utility model has effectively utilized little of bamboo timber resources such as level mao bamboon, cizu, bambusa textile, cotton bamboo, Dendrocalamus sinicus, the bamboo strip of the bamboo wood veneer big with longitudinal strength, that hardness is high, wear-resisting is as the surface of surface layer and bottom, with bamboo wood or masson pine, density board, fast growing wood as core material, with modified environment-friendly phenolic resins or modified environment-friendly Lauxite is adhesive, through bonding the forming of special heat pressing process gummed, kept bamboo green layer natural, ecological macromolecular compound to greatest extent.Therefore, its longitudinal strength is big, good rigidly, the elastic modelling quantity height, case hardness height, wear resistant corrosion resistant, the ratio of strength to weight is better than steel, be fit to make household floor, chassis of bus, storehouse peculiar to vessel plate, container bottom board, furniture-plates, bamboo wood structure room with material, architecture engineering material etc., have wide range of applications, cost is low.
Description of drawings
Fig. 1 is the structural representation of the utility model embodiment 1.
Fig. 2 is the structural representation of the utility model embodiment 2.
The specific embodiment
The utility model will be further described below in conjunction with drawings and Examples.
The manufacturing process of launching the bamboo wood recombination single-plate is: at first, former bamboo is sawed tube by certain length specification, again thick bamboo tube is cutd open and be cleaved into bulk arc bamboo chip, special-purpose bamboo wood expansion milling machine with development launches the arc bamboo chip and mills to put down to form a developed plantform integral body, through boiling, drying, fixed thick, the softening operations such as making horizontal veneer of recombinating of hot pressing, launch the bamboo wood recombination single-plate and make.
Referring to Fig. 1, it is the structural representation of the utility model embodiment 1, its adopt to launch bamboo wood recombination single-plate 1 as surface layer, launch bamboo wood recombination single-plate 2 as sandwich layer, launch bamboo wood recombination single-plate 3 as bottom, the gauge of its three layers of bamboo wood veneers reasonably mates, and forms through the compound hot pressing of modified environment-friendly phenolic resins adhesive layer collection.Its facing surface and bottom surface are bamboo strips, and therefore the surface has kept bigger hardness and intensity, the bamboo fiber direction vertical consistency stack of three layers of bamboo wood veneer, and its surperficial ring is conjuncted relatively, has strengthened the aesthetic feeling of bamboo wood.
Referring to Fig. 2, it is the structural representation of the utility model embodiment 2, its adopt to launch bamboo wood recombination single-plate 4 as surface layer, launch bamboo wood recombination single-plate 5 as sandwich layer, launch bamboo wood recombination single-plate 6 as bottom, the gauge of its three layers of bamboo wood veneers reasonably mates, and forms through the compound hot pressing of modified environment-friendly Lauxite adhesive layer collection.Its facing surface and bottom surface are bamboo strips, the surface has kept bigger hardness and intensity, the bamboo fiber direction vertical consistency stack of surface layer 4 and bottom 6 bamboo wood veneers, and the bamboo fiber of the bamboo wood veneer of sandwich layer 5 laterally superposes, therefore three layers of bamboo wood veneer are crisscross stacks.
Core material of the present utility model also can adopt wood single-plate, such as: masson pine, density board, fast growing wood etc.
